⊗jsOpBsOIC 22 of 60 menu

Objek di Dalam Kelas dalam OOP di JavaScript

Dalam kelas, kita dapat menggunakan objek kelas lain. Mari kita lihat contohnya. Misalkan kita ingin membuat pengguna dengan nama depan dan belakang, serta kota tempat tinggalnya. Misalkan kita memiliki kelas berikut untuk kota:

class City { constructor(name) { this.name = name; } }

Kita akan memasukkan nama depan, belakang, dan kota sebagai parameter konstruktor:

class User { constructor(name, surn, city) { this.name = name; this.surn = surn; this.city = city; } }

Dalam hal ini, nama depan dan belakang akan berupa string, sedangkan kota - berupa objek dari kelasnya sendiri:

let city = new City('luis'); let user = new User('john', 'smit', city);

Mari kita tampilkan nama depan pengguna kita:

console.log(user.name);

Sekarang mari tampilkan nama kota untuk pengguna kita:

console.log(user.city.name);

Berikut adalah kelas yang diberikan:

class Employee { constructor(name, position, department) { this.name = name; this.position = position; this.department = department; } }

Buatlah agar parameter kedua dan ketiga diisi dengan objek dari kelas terpisah.

Buat sebuah objek karyawan menggunakan kelas dari tugas sebelumnya.

Tampilkan di konsol: nama, posisi/jabatan, dan departemen untuk karyawan yang telah dibuat.

Indonesia
AfrikaansAzərbaycanБългарскиবাংলাБеларускаяČeštinaDanskDeutschΕλληνικάEnglishEspañolEestiSuomiFrançaisहिन्दीMagyarՀայերենItaliano日本語ქართულიҚазақ한국어КыргызчаLietuviųLatviešuМакедонскиMelayuမြန်မာNederlandsNorskPolskiPortuguêsRomânăРусскийසිංහලSlovenčinaSlovenščinaShqipСрпскиSrpskiSvenskaKiswahiliТоҷикӣไทยTürkmenTürkçeЎзбекOʻzbekTiếng Việt
Kami menggunakan cookie untuk operasi situs, analitik, dan personalisasi. Pemrosesan data dilakukan sesuai dengan Kebijakan Privasi.
terima semua atur tolak